見出し画像

ATMegaの最強省電力スリープ頂上決戦を勝手にやってみた!!


こんにちは皆さん。
今回はこの世の中に出回っている色んなAVRマイコン用の
スリープ機能の中からどれが一番省電力なのか、
検証した結果を記事にしてみました!!

電池を使用した製品開発をご検討の方!
省電力製品の開発をご検討の方!
490円のケーキを一つ買うの我慢してこの記事を見てみませんか?

①ラジオペンチ様の「delayWDT2」 


ラジオペンチ様の記事を拝見すると様々な記事を確認しながら
このスリープ機能を開発されたようです。
果たしてどのような結果になるのか?!


②7ujm様の「wdt_enable_test」


7ujm様は、レジスタの分析もしながらこのスリープを開発したようです。
その効果はどのようにして省電力に貢献しているのでしょうか?!


③HIRAMINE様の「Sleep」


HIRAMINE様のSleepは非常にわかりやすい説明がされており、
プログラム構築もすごく簡単にできました。
省電力にも期待できそうです!!


sleemanj様の「SimpleSleep」


sleemanj様は、海外の方で「SimpleSleep」をC++で
作成されているようです。
使い方も非常に簡単そうでこれに省電力機能も追加されれば
鬼に金棒ですね!!


⑤みは様の「watchDogSleep」


みは様は、youtubeにも実際の電力測定値を掲載しております。
結果が見える化されているので非常に期待ができますね!!


今回のテスト環境


今回は以下の回路で動作確認を行っています。
5Vの供給ラインに電流テスターを設けております。

検証結果!!

ここから先は

3,170字 / 4画像

¥ 490

期間限定!PayPayで支払うと抽選でお得

この記事が気に入ったらチップで応援してみませんか?